Policy & Regulatory Briefing: Oil Reserve, Efficiency, EPA Bills
Obama administration officials announced yesterday that they will tap into the country’s strategic oil reserve to replace losses from the conflict in Libya and ensure the country has enough supplies to get through the summer. An Obama administration official says the release of 60 million barrels represents less than five percent of the reserve, the New York Times reports.
